Windows Mobile 6, Anyone Else Loving It?

I got my email setup to be pushed to device from exchange server as well as contacts/calender/tasks, Loving the Windows Live to got Hotmail email setup to be pushed to device as well as Microsoft Alerts, eg.. MSN News, so recieve the latest news/entertainment headlines straight on my phone..

Only thing missing is a decent web browser and Xbox Live Friends List...
